发明名称 Control mechanism for motor vehicle power transmission mechanism
摘要 463,683. Fluid-pressure servomotors. GENERAL MOTORS CORPORATION. Oct. 3, 1935, No. 34532/36. Convention date, Oct. 8, 1934. Divided out of 463,643. [Class 135] [Also in Group XXIV] Control mechanism for stepwise change-speed gearing is conjoint between a speedresponsive device driven from one of the shafts and an engine control means which. act on snap-action valve mechanism of fluid-pressure servo means for effecting speed changes, there being further control means by which the operator can override the said conjoint control. Pumped oil is delivered to a manifold at 136, and 140 is the snap-action valve. A snap spring 160 snaps a toggle 157, 158 about a fixed pivot 156, and there is a bias spring 164 holding the valve 140 normally in the position shown with the oil cut off from a speed-changing servomotor 138, and an automatic two-speed unit held in high speed. The conjoint control is applied at 167 through a floating lever 166, a speed-responsive governor 211 acting through a link 170 on a lower fulcrum 169, and the accelerator, not shown, acting through a shaft 173 on a middle fulcrum 175. The over-riding control acts through the shaft 173 on the fulcrum 175 to force the valve 140 open, that is to force a down-shift in the automatic unit, all as described in Specification 463,643. In the arrangement described, there is a second or manual control for a second transmission unit, said control acting through a crank 192 on a second snap-action valve 140<1>, all as described in the Specification referred to.
